Output 57540717f78cf942da26e54ce9b19660a309db0958cbbc48e3f8c29118219bd6:1

value
80548763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e4bce2e983cef3c5ba8257af6991d8689fd20d6 OP_EQUAL
address
MAfMKEfvRbG4wRByGD7ZitiQL2ugMbuowg
transaction
57540717f78cf942da26e54ce9b19660a309db0958cbbc48e3f8c29118219bd6
spent
true